the console output while wine-0.9.20 was failing to install topo again.
Ahem, running winecfg, after the exception got raised I was presented with a
dialog box filled with random glyphs, and clicked on the right hand button.
However, after I pushed submit when trying:
wine /media/CA_D01/setup.exe
just now, I noticed that I had been once again presented with the same dialog
box full of random glyphs, so for grins I clicked the left hand button, and
remarkably, the installation started. InstallShield quickly threw up a dialog
saying that it had finished and asking me to reboot, but before I could
respond, another InstallShield box appeared, covering the first saying that it
was installing. After the typical message/confirmation dialogs about using the
defaults, then a progress bar of the copying and installation, a second dialog
saying that it had finished and asking me to reboot appeared and I clicked
"yes, reboot now". The first finished/reboot? dialog persisted so I clicked yes
again. Unfortunately, the install appears to have failed, as wine crashes when
I try to run the just installed application. The attachment contains the
console output from this experiment.
